En línea o en el sitio, los cursos de capacitación en vivo de Desarrollo Impulsado por el Comportamiento (BDD) dirigidos por un instructor cubren varias aplicaciones del mundo real para BDD. Los cursos cubren áreas como Acceptance Test Driven Development (ATDD), Test Driven Development (TDD), Cucumber y el lenguaje Gherkin.
La capacitación BDD está disponible como "capacitación en vivo en línea" o "capacitación en vivo en el sitio". La capacitación en vivo en línea (también conocida como "capacitación remota en vivo") se lleva a cabo a través de un escritorio remoto interactivo <a href = "https://www.dadesktop.com/>". La capacitación en vivo in situ se puede llevar a cabo localmente en las instalaciones del cliente en Peru o en los centros de capacitación corporativa de NobleProg en Peru.
Behave es un marco BDD de código abierto basado en Python para escribir pruebas en un estilo de lenguaje natural.
BDD, o Behavior Driven Development, es una técnica ágil de desarrollo de software que fomenta la colaboración entre desarrolladores, QA y personas de negocios no técnicos en un proyecto de software.
Esta capacitación comienza con una discusión sobre BDD y sobre cómo el marco de Behave se puede usar para llevar a cabo pruebas de BDD para aplicaciones web. Los participantes tienen amplias oportunidades de interactuar con el instructor y sus compañeros mientras implementan los conceptos y las tácticas aprendidas en este práctico entorno práctico de laboratorio.
Al final de esta capacitación, los participantes comprenderán con firmeza BDD y Behave, así como la práctica necesaria para implementar estas técnicas y herramientas en escenarios de prueba del mundo real.
Audiencia
Probadores y Desarrolladores
Formato del curso
Gran énfasis en la práctica práctica. La mayoría de los conceptos se aprenden a través de muestras, ejercicios y desarrollo práctico.
"Entre el 40% y el 70% del tiempo invertido por muchos equipos de automatización de pruebas se dedica al mantenimiento de sus suites de prueba ... ya sea refactorizando pruebas porque la aplicación cambió pero también examinando los resultados de las pruebas cuando se rompen ..." - - John Furguson Smart, creador de Serenity.
Serenity es una biblioteca abierta de informes de código abierto que permite a los evaluadores escribir criterios de aceptación bien estructurados y mantenibles. Serenity produce informes de pruebas completos y significativos ("documentación viviente") que no solo informan los resultados de las pruebas, sino que también documentan lo que hicieron, en un formato narrativo paso a paso que incluye datos de prueba y capturas de pantalla.
En esta capacitación, los participantes aprenderán cómo escribir pruebas de alta calidad mediante el uso de "guiones" y la idea de "actores, tareas y objetivos" para expresar pruebas en términos comerciales en lugar de como interacciones entre los componentes del sistema. Analizamos escenarios de pruebas funcionales y de IU y demostramos cómo se puede utilizar Serenity para administrar sus pruebas. Todas las conferencias, notas, quizes y debates van acompañados de prácticas prácticas e implementación.
Al final de esta capacitación, los participantes comprenderán el marco de Serenity y podrán utilizarlo con comodidad. Como importante, los participantes aprenderán a pensar y abordar la automatización de pruebas desde una perspectiva diferente.
Audiencia
Probadores de automatización
Formato del curso
Este curso guía a los participantes a través de casos de la vida real para el Desarrollo impulsado por el comportamiento (BDD) y demuestra cómo implementar Serenity en varios escenarios de prueba.
BDD, o Behavior Driven Development, es una técnica ágil de desarrollo de software que fomenta la colaboración entre desarrolladores, equipos de control de calidad y personas de negocios no técnicos a lo largo del ciclo de planificación, desarrollo y prueba de un proyecto de software.
El taller comienza con una introducción a BDD, qué es y cómo lo utilizan las empresas para promover un buen diseño, desarrollo y pruebas de software. Hacemos esto desde un punto de vista que no es de ingeniería, con la vista puesta en los usuarios finales, sus requisitos, el lenguaje y su forma de pensar. También abordamos los desafíos de comunicación que las partes interesadas de negocios probablemente encontrarán a medida que trabajen más cerca con sus pares de mentalidad técnica.
Al final de esta capacitación, los participantes sabrán cómo:
Escriba historias de usuarios sucintas que capturen los patrones de uso de usuarios reales del software
Traduzca sus historias de usuarios en el lenguaje conductual de BDD (Given, When, Then)
Derivar casos de prueba de estas historias, para que los ingenieros los implementen y prueben
Comprender la relación entre los requisitos del producto, los criterios de aceptación y los casos de prueba
Desmitificar la jerga técnica que impide la comunicación y la comprensión
Instale y use excelentes herramientas para escribir archivos de características de BDD
Comprenda y aprecie lo que sucede una vez que el trabajo se entrega a los ingenieros
Juega un papel más activo en el ciclo de desarrollo iterativo
Audiencia
Propietarios y gerentes de producto
Analistas comerciales
Comprobadores manuales
Usuarios finales de un producto o sistema de software
No ingenieros y no codificadores involucrados en el diseño de productos
Formato del curso
Un taller interactivo dirigido por un instructor con muchas actividades y prácticas.
Notas
El taller incluye casos de estudio y muestras de software. Para personalizar los materiales para el producto y la situación de su empresa, póngase en contacto con nosotros para organizar.
La capacitación está diseñada para el personal de TI y de negocios. El objetivo del curso es proporcionar una forma de facilitar la comunicación entre los departamentos en el proceso de desarrollo de software. Los participantes aprenden las pruebas de comportamiento para que sea posible crear software más confiable sin la necesidad de herramientas costosas y avanzadas.
Cucumber Electron es un marco para escribir pruebas BDD (Desarrollo conducido por comportamiento) en lenguaje sencillo, con Electron, un marco para crear aplicaciones de escritorio que usan tecnologías web. Está destinado a probar aplicaciones web de JavaScript.
En esta capacitación en vivo dirigida por un instructor, los participantes aprenderán cómo escribir y ejecutar casos de prueba de estilo BDD para aplicaciones node.js usando Cucumber Electron.
Al final de esta capacitación, los participantes podrán:
Ejecute las pruebas de BDD y el código de la aplicación en un único proceso (sin transpiling)
Escribir pruebas que son más rápidas, menos frágiles y más fáciles de depurar
Audiencia
Desarrolladores
Formato del curso
Conferencia de parte, discusión en parte, ejercicios y práctica práctica
El Robot Framework es un marco de automatización de pruebas de código abierto para pruebas de aceptación y desarrollo basado en pruebas de aceptación (ATDD). Utiliza palabras clave para abstraer los detalles de una prueba, transmitiendo la intención en lugar de los aspectos prácticos. El marco principal se implementa en Python y se puede ejecutar en Jython (JVM) e IronPython (.NET). Robot Framework fue originalmente desarrollado por Nokia.
En esta capacitación en vivo dirigida por un instructor, los participantes aprenderán cómo escribir un conjunto de casos de prueba y un conjunto de pruebas, luego ejecutarán las pruebas en una aplicación de demostración.
Al final de esta capacitación, los participantes podrán:
Utilice el enfoque de prueba basado en palabras clave de Robot Framework y la sintaxis de datos de prueba tabular para escribir y ejecutar pruebas
Use una sintaxis consistente para componer palabras clave nuevas a partir de las existentes
Llevar a cabo pruebas de Desarrollo conducido por comportamientos (BDD) de estilo pepinillo (similar al pepino)
Genere e interprete informes y registros para solucionar fallas en la aplicación probada
Las capacidades de Extended Robot Framework utilizan bibliotecas de terceros escritas en Python, Java, Perl, Javascript y PHP
Integrar Robot Framework con Selenium para probar aplicaciones web
Audiencia
Ingenieros de prueba de software
Formato del curso
Conferencia de parte, discusión en parte, ejercicios y práctica práctica
Este curso de un día guía a los participantes a través de los fundamentos de RSpec , BDD (Behavior Driven Development) y otros métodos de prueba con ejercicios prácticos.
El desarrollo impulsado por el comportamiento (BDD) es una metodología ágil cuyo objetivo es mejorar la comunicación y la colaboración entre los desarrolladores de software, los evaluadores de calidad / probadores, los analistas de negocios y otras partes involucradas en un proyecto.
Cucumber es un marco de código abierto "basado en la historia" escrito en Ruby. Permite el Desarrollo Dirigido por Comportamiento (BDD) al permitir la creación de pruebas que sean comprensibles tanto para personas técnicas como no técnicas, como las partes interesadas del negocio.
Este curso guía a los participantes a través de casos de la vida real para el Desarrollo impulsado por el comportamiento (BDD) y demuestra cómo implementar el Pepino en varios escenarios de prueba.
Audiencia
Probadores y Desarrolladores
Formato del curso
El curso incluye una discusión sobre el Desarrollo impulsado por comportamiento (BDD) y cómo Cucumber se puede utilizar para llevar a cabo pruebas de BDD en varios contextos, como las pruebas de aplicaciones web. Los participantes serán guiados a través de la escritura de sus propias historias de usuario, casos de prueba y código de prueba ejecutable.
Cucumber es un marco BDD de fuente abierta para escribir pruebas en un estilo de lenguaje natural. BDD, o Behavior Driven Development, es una técnica ágil de desarrollo de software que fomenta la colaboración entre desarrolladores, QA y personas de negocios no técnicos en un proyecto de software.
Esta capacitación comienza con una discusión sobre BDD y cómo Cucumber se usa para llevar a cabo pruebas de BDD para aplicaciones web. Los participantes tienen amplias oportunidades de interactuar con el instructor y sus compañeros mientras implementan los conceptos y las tácticas aprendidas en este práctico entorno práctico de laboratorio.
Al final de esta capacitación, los participantes comprenderán a fondo BDD y Cucumber, así como la práctica y el conjunto de herramientas necesarias para escribir sus propios casos de prueba para escenarios de pruebas de software del mundo real.
Audiencia
Probadores y Desarrolladores
Formato del curso
Gran énfasis en la práctica práctica. La mayoría de los conceptos se aprenden a través de muestras, ejercicios y desarrollo práctico.
Nota
Esta capacitación usa Eclipse y Selenium. Si desea utilizar un IDE diferente o un marco de automatización de prueba, contáctenos para organizarlo.
Si su equipo está pasando de las pruebas manuales a las pruebas de automatización por primera vez, contáctenos para organizar la extensión de la capacitación e incluir una cobertura adicional de las pruebas de automatización.
Cucumber.js es una implementación nativa de JavaScript de Cucumber.
En esta capacitación en vivo dirigida por un instructor, los participantes aprenderán cómo escribir y ejecutar casos de prueba de estilo BDD (Conducta impulsada por el comportamiento) utilizando Cucumber y Javascript.
Al final de esta capacitación, los participantes podrán:
Ejecute pruebas automatizadas escritas en lenguaje legible por humanos, Gherkin
Use casos de prueba basados en Cucumber para mejorar la comunicación y la colaboración entre equipos técnicos y no técnicos
Integre Cucumber.js con otros marcos de prueba, como el transportador para probar aplicaciones angulares
Audiencia
Ingenieros de prueba de software
Desarrolladores
Formato del curso
Conferencia de parte, discusión en parte, ejercicios y práctica práctica
Iridium es una herramienta de prueba web de código abierto construida en torno a pepino y selenio. Utiliza un enfoque de Desarrollo basado en el comportamiento (BDD) para las pruebas.
En esta capacitación en vivo dirigida por un instructor, los participantes aprenderán cómo probar una aplicación web compleja utilizando Iridium.
Al final de esta capacitación, los participantes podrán:
Cree pruebas de extremo a extremo que simulen las acciones de un usuario mientras navega por una aplicación web
Automatice las pruebas de aplicaciones temáticas con múltiples estilos
Cree casos de prueba que sean legibles para personas no técnicas
Ejecute pruebas en una amplia variedad de navegadores
Utilice el paquete Iridium Snippets para Atom para facilitar la escritura de scripts de prueba
Reduzca los costos de mantenimiento de código personalizado de Java y objetos de página
Audiencia
Ingenieros de prueba
Desarrolladores
Formato del curso
Conferencia de parte, discusión en parte, ejercicios y práctica práctica
JBehave es un marco de BDD basado en Java de código abierto para escribir pruebas en un estilo de lenguaje natural. BDD, o Behavior Driven Development, es una técnica ágil de desarrollo de software que fomenta la colaboración entre desarrolladores, QA y personas de negocios no técnicos en un proyecto de software.
Esta capacitación comienza con una discusión sobre BDD y sobre cómo se puede usar el marco JBehave para realizar pruebas de BDD para aplicaciones web. Los participantes tienen amplias oportunidades de interactuar con el instructor y sus compañeros mientras implementan los conceptos y las tácticas aprendidas en este práctico entorno práctico de laboratorio.
Al final de esta capacitación, los participantes comprenderán firmemente BDD y JBehave, así como la práctica y el conjunto de herramientas necesarias para escribir casos de prueba para escenarios de pruebas de software reales.
Audiencia
Probadores y Desarrolladores
Formato del curso
Gran énfasis en la práctica práctica. La mayoría de los conceptos se aprenden a través de muestras, ejercicios y desarrollo práctico.
Behat es un marco de prueba de Desarrollo impulsado por comportamiento (BDD) escrito en PHP. Facilita la comunicación entre desarrolladores, probadores, partes interesadas comerciales y clientes durante el proceso de desarrollo de software. Behat permite a las personas no técnicas escribir descripciones claras del comportamiento previsto de una aplicación, luego ejecuta esos "escenarios" como pruebas funcionales contra la aplicación.
En esta capacitación en vivo dirigida por un instructor, los participantes aprenderán a escribir y ejecutar casos de prueba de estilo BDD utilizando Behat y PHP.
Al final de esta capacitación, los participantes podrán:
Ejecute pruebas automáticas escritas en el lenguaje Gherkin "legible para los humanos"
Utilice casos de prueba basados en Behat para mejorar la colaboración entre equipos técnicos y no técnicos
Integre Behat con Selenium, Mink, Goutte y otros emuladores de navegador para realizar pruebas y generar informes
Extienda la funcionalidad de Behat a través de su sistema de extensión
Pruebe numerosos escenarios de uso a través de comandos de terminal, API REST y más.
Audiencia
Ingenieros de prueba
Desarrolladores
Formato del curso
Conferencia de parte, discusión en parte, ejercicios y práctica práctica
SpecFlow es la implementación oficial de Cucumber para .NET. Permite a los evaluadores definir, administrar y ejecutar automáticamente pruebas de aceptación legibles por humanos en proyectos .NET. SpecFlow utiliza el analizador oficial de Gherkin y es compatible con .NET framework, Xamarin y Mono.
En esta capacitación en vivo dirigida por un instructor, los participantes aprenderán cómo usar SpecFlow para escribir pruebas de aceptación que sean comprensibles tanto para los interesados técnicos como para los no técnicos.
Al final de esta capacitación, los participantes podrán:
Ate los requisitos comerciales al código .NET
Aplique técnicas de BDD para crear documentación de vida para una aplicación
Ejecute SpecFlow desde Visual Studio o la línea de comando
Integre SpecFlow en un entorno de pruebas y construcción continuo existente
Integre SpecFlow con otros marcos de prueba tales como MSTest, NUnit, xUnit y MbUnit
Audiencia
Ingenieros de prueba
Desarrolladores
Formato del curso
Conferencia de parte, discusión en parte, ejercicios y práctica práctica
Last Updated:
Próximos Cursos BDD (Behavior Driven Development)
Cucumber: implementando BDD con Java
2023-12-11 09:30
7 horas
Cucumber: implementando BDD con Java
2023-12-25 09:30
7 horas
Iridium: Cucumber y Selenium sobre la base de pruebas
2024-01-08 09:30
7 horas
Cucumber: Implementación de Desarrollo Impulsado por el Comportamiento (BDD) con Cucumber
2024-01-22 09:30
14 horas
SpecFlow: Implementando BDD para .NET
2024-02-05 09:30
21 horas
Cucumber: Implementación de Desarrollo Impulsado por el Comportamiento (BDD) con Cucumber
Cursos de Fin de Semana de BDD (Behavior Driven Development), Capacitación por la Tarde de Behavior Driven Development (BDD), BDD boot camp, Clases de BDD, Capacitación de Fin de Semana de Behavior Driven Development (BDD), Cursos por la Tarde de BDD (Behavior Driven Development), Behavior Driven Development coaching, Instructor de Behavior Driven Development (BDD), Capacitador de Behavior Driven Development (BDD), Behavior Driven Development con instructor, Cursos de Formación de BDD (Behavior Driven Development), Behavior Driven Development en sitio, Cursos Privados de BDD, Clases Particulares de BDD, Capacitación empresarial de Behavior Driven Development, Talleres para empresas de BDD, Cursos en linea de BDD, Programas de capacitación de Behavior Driven Development (BDD), Clases de BDD
Promociones
No hay descuentos de cursos por ahora.
Descuentos en los Cursos
Respetamos la privacidad de su dirección de correo electrónico. No transmitiremos ni venderemos su dirección a otras personas. En cualquier momento puede cambiar sus preferencias o cancelar su suscripción por completo.
is growing fast!
We are looking to expand our presence in Peru!
As a Business Development Manager you will:
expand business in Peru
recruit local talent (sales, agents, trainers, consultants)
recruit local trainers and consultants
We offer:
Artificial Intelligence and Big Data systems to support your local operation
high-tech automation
continuously upgraded course catalogue and content
good fun in international team
If you are interested in running a high-tech, high-quality training and consulting business.